United as one, divided by zero by exsanguinatrix
I am thinking of a word that indicates the state of being anonymous. Anonymity. But I am thinking of 'anonymosity,' which is not a real word, but is more apt. Bloggers, or the denizens of the internet (or intarwebz to be precise), all revel in their/ our anonymosity in varying levels.

There is a trick here. The notion that being anonymous denotes dishonesty, that to hide one's identity is to be untruthful. The trick here is in thinking that a person's real nature is the person we can see, the person IRL. How completely asinine. >>>continue reading

If you want to vote, these are the guidelines:

* To promote peer-to-peer recognition and respect only bona fide bloggers can vote for the competition. Anonymous voters without a valid blog will not be added to the tally of votes.

* Voters must be blogging for at least three (3) months with a minimum of thirty entries in his blog prior to his voting in the competition. This will eliminate phantom voters and reduce incidence of cheating.

* One vote is tallied as 100 points. A voter is allowed to pick three best entries among the finalists.

* The votes are added up and the winner is declared with a Reader’s Choice Award citation.

* The total number of votes (converted into weights) are added to the other weight points as set in the Winner Selection Criteria.

Are you qualified to vote? Then LEAVE A COMMENT here (please don't use the chatbox) with your three (3) best entry picks. We will manually check your blog for qualification requirements before counting your votes.

Voting ends 20th June 2008.
